Ingredients:
Red Layer
-
2 cups halved, hulled strawberries
-
1 tablespoon sugar
-
2 tablespoons Woodbridge by Robert Mondavi Cabernet Sauvignon
White Layer
-
1 cup Greek yogurt
-
2 tablespoons heavy cream
-
2 tablespoons granulated sugar
-
2 tablespoons lime juice
Blue Layer
-
2 cups blueberries
-
½ cup blackberries
-
2 tablespoons granulated sugar
-
2 tablespoons lime juice

Directions:
Red Layer
-
Place all ingredients in a blender. Puree until smooth.
-
Fill the Popsicle molds 1/3 of the way.
-
Freeze until firm, about 30 minutes.
White Layer
-
Place all ingredients in a blender. Blend until combined.
-
Remove the molds from the freezer and fill each another 1/3 of the way.
-
Freeze until firm, another 30 minutes.
Blue Layer
-
Place all ingredients in a blender. Blend until combined.
-
Remove the molds from the freezer and fill each another 1/3 of the way.
-
Leave about ¼ inch of space at the top of the mold.
-
Freeze until solid, about 5 hours.
*You may have extra fruit puree, depending on the size of your berries.
